`48 People Have Fallen Victim`: Ministers, MLAs In Karnataka Allege `Honey Trap` Attempts, State Home Minister Promises Probe

Zee News Friday, 21 March 2025
Several MLAs in Karnataka across party lines made a serious revelation on Thursday and alleged that "honey trap" attempts were being made in the state to achieve political goals. Backing the claims made by opposition leaders in the state, Karnataka Home Minister G. Parameshwara assured a high-level inquiry into such cases. Responding to the accusations, Parameshwara emphasized the need to curb such tendencies.
